Heinie Custom Colt

pistol_purview This beautiful 1911 with a Nowlin match grade barrel and Heinie sights (of course) was built by living legend Richard Heinie. This gun is numbered RH395, which is always engraved under the thumb safety. RH is regarded as one of the greatest 1911 smiths of all time. Berryhill Custom Colt

pistol_purview Colt 1911 in .45 ACP by master gunsmith Dave Berryhill of Prosper Texas. Dave was an armorer for various SWAT and law enforcement teams for over twenty years.
